diff options
author | Martin Pitt <martinpitt@gnome.org> | 2013-11-07 16:37:05 +0100 |
---|---|---|
committer | Martin Pitt <martinpitt@gnome.org> | 2013-11-07 16:37:05 +0100 |
commit | f25f929a1574a2d874d164895ec6693abb87025b (patch) | |
tree | 9b683ed310504bbcce2a1a7bed821b16f25e5fe5 /test | |
parent | cadb7298c3e55a54889dbf735765f49accfa9c18 (diff) | |
download | gvfs-f25f929a1574a2d874d164895ec6693abb87025b.tar.gz |
gvfs-test: Refresh MTP record
- DCIM/100CANON/IMG_000?.JPG are from test/files/source-gphoto/
- sine.ogg was generated with
gst-launch-1.0 audiotestsrc num-buffers=10 ! audioconvert ! \
audioresample ! vorbisenc ! oggmux ! filesink location=sine.ogg
- Record started with
umockdev-record -i /dev/bus/usb/001/017=test/files/mtp_xperia.ioctl /usr/lib/gvfs/gvfsd
- Recorded commands (in a different terminal):
gvfs-mount 'mtp://[usb:001,017]'
gvfs-ls 'mtp://[usb:001,017]/SD-Karte'
gvfs-ls 'mtp://[usb:001,017]/SD-Karte/Music'
gvfs-ls 'mtp://[usb:001,017]/SD-Karte/Music/GStreamer - The Test Sine'
gvfs-info 'mtp://[usb:001,017]/SD-Karte/Music/GStreamer - The Test Sine'
gvfs-info 'mtp://[usb:001,017]/SD-Karte/Music/GStreamer - The Test Sine/sine.ogg'
gvfs-cat 'mtp://[usb:001,017]/SD-Karte/Music/GStreamer - The Test Sine/sine.ogg'
gvfs-cat 'mtp://[usb:001,017]/SD-Karte/hello.txt'
gvfs-info 'mtp://[usb:001,017]/SD-Karte/hello.txt'
gvfs-info 'mtp://[usb:001,017]/SD-Karte/DCIM/100CANON/IMG_0001.JPG'
gvfs-cat 'mtp://[usb:001,017]/SD-Karte/DCIM/100CANON/IMG_0001.JPG'
gvfs-mount -u 'mtp://[usb:001,017]'
Diffstat (limited to 'test')
-rw-r--r-- | test/files/mtp_xperia.ioctl.xz | bin | 8184 -> 5556 bytes | |||
-rwxr-xr-x | test/gvfs-test | 4 |
2 files changed, 2 insertions, 2 deletions
diff --git a/test/files/mtp_xperia.ioctl.xz b/test/files/mtp_xperia.ioctl.xz Binary files differindex f929398f..a39c320c 100644 --- a/test/files/mtp_xperia.ioctl.xz +++ b/test/files/mtp_xperia.ioctl.xz diff --git a/test/gvfs-test b/test/gvfs-test index 7360d539..1598a407 100755 --- a/test/gvfs-test +++ b/test/gvfs-test @@ -1750,7 +1750,7 @@ class Mtp(GvfsTestCase): out = self.program_out_success(['gvfs-info', uri + '/SD-Karte/Music/GStreamer - The Test Sine/sine.ogg']) self.assertIn('standard::content-type: audio/ogg', out) - self.assertIn('standard::size: 4400', out) + self.assertIn('standard::size: 4033', out) self.assertIn('access::can-read: TRUE', out) self.assertIn('access::can-write: TRUE', out) self.assertIn('access::can-delete: TRUE', out) @@ -1769,7 +1769,7 @@ class Mtp(GvfsTestCase): # photo out = self.program_out_success(['gvfs-info', uri + '/SD-Karte/DCIM/100CANON/IMG_0001.JPG']) self.assertIn('standard::content-type: image/jpeg', out) - self.assertIn('standard::size: 8843', out) + self.assertIn('standard::size: 4151', out) self.assertIn('preview::icon:', out) out = subprocess.check_output(['gvfs-cat', uri + '/SD-Karte/DCIM/100CANON/IMG_0001.JPG']) |